الطائرة هي نظام تتبع الأخطاء وإدارة المشاريع مفتوح المصدر.

يتوفر إصدار منصة Plane 0.7، وهو يوفر أدوات لإدارة المشاريع وتتبع الأخطاء وتخطيط العمل ودعم تطوير المنتج وبناء قائمة المهام وتنسيق تنفيذها. يتم تطوير النظام الأساسي، الذي يمكن نشره على بنيته التحتية الخاصة ولا يعتمد على مقدمي خدمات خارجيين، ليكون بمثابة نظير مفتوح لأنظمة خاصة مثل JIRA وLinear وHeight. المشروع في مرحلة التطوير ويستعد لتشكيل الإصدار المستقر الأول. تمت كتابة التعليمات البرمجية بلغة Python باستخدام إطار عمل Django ويتم توزيعها بموجب ترخيص Apache 2.0. يتم استخدام PostgreSQL كنظام إدارة قواعد البيانات (DBMS)، ويستخدم Redis للتخزين السريع. تمت كتابة واجهة الويب بلغة TypeScript باستخدام مكتبة Next.js.

يدعم المستوى أنواعًا مختلفة من سير العمل ويسمح لك بتتبع المهام المعينة (ToDo) وقائمة المهام (المتراكمة) والمهام قيد التقدم والمهام المكتملة بشكل منفصل. تم تصميم النظام لاستخدام أساليب تطوير المشروعات الشلالية والمرنة. في نموذج الشلال، يُنظر إلى التطوير على أنه تدفق مستمر، يمر بشكل متسلسل عبر مراحل التخطيط وتحليل المتطلبات والتصميم والتنفيذ والاختبار والتكامل والدعم. في النموذج المرن، ينقسم تطوير المشروع إلى أجزاء صغيرة منفصلة تضمن التطوير التدريجي للوظائف، وفي تنفيذها تمر بالمراحل النموذجية لتطوير المشروع بأكمله، مثل التخطيط وتحليل المتطلبات والتصميم والتطوير والاختبار والتوثيق.

الملامح الرئيسية للطائرة:

  • تتبع الأخطاء وتخطيط العمل. يتم دعم ثلاثة أوضاع عرض - القائمة والبطاقة الافتراضية (كانبان) والتقويم. من الممكن ربط الوظائف بموظفين محددين. للتحرير، يتم استخدام محرر مرئي مع دعم العلامات (نص منسق). من الممكن إرفاق الملفات وإضافة روابط إلى مهام أخرى وترك التعليقات وإجراء المناقشات.
    الطائرة - نظام مفتوح لتتبع الأخطاء وإدارة المشاريع
  • دورات التطوير هي الفترة الزمنية التي يخطط خلالها الفريق لإكمال المرحلة التالية من التطوير. عادةً ما يؤدي إكمال الدورة إلى تكوين نسخة جديدة. توفر واجهة الدورة معلومات واضحة حول تقدم التطوير.
    الطائرة - نظام مفتوح لتتبع الأخطاء وإدارة المشاريع
  • الوحدات - القدرة على تقسيم المشاريع الكبيرة إلى أجزاء صغيرة، والتي يمكن تعيين تطويرها لفرق مختلفة وتنسيقها بشكل منفصل.
    الطائرة - نظام مفتوح لتتبع الأخطاء وإدارة المشاريع
  • طرق العرض - القدرة على التصفية عند عرض المهام والقضايا المهمة لموظف معين فقط.
  • الصفحات - يتيح لك استخدام مساعد الذكاء الاصطناعي لتدوين الملاحظات وتوثيق المشكلات والخطط التي تم تطويرها بسرعة أثناء المناقشات.
    الطائرة - نظام مفتوح لتتبع الأخطاء وإدارة المشاريع
  • قائمة عالمية يتم استدعاؤها بالضغط على "Ctrl + K" وتوفير القدرة على التنقل بسرعة عبر جميع المشاريع.
  • التكامل مع الخدمات الخارجية، على سبيل المثال، تسليم الإشعارات عبر Slack ومزامنة المشكلات مع GitHub.
  • إدارة الموظفين والفرق. مستويات مختلفة من السلطة (المالك، المسؤول، المشارك، المراقب). دعم لتحديد حالات المشكلة المختلفة لأوامر مختلفة.
  • القدرة على تغيير المظهر واستخدام أوضاع العرض المظلمة.

التحسينات الرئيسية في الإصدار الجديد:

  • تمت إضافة قسم تحليلات يسمح لك بتقييم عمل كل موظف بشكل مرئي ودراسة تقدم المشروع وتتبع ديناميكيات العمل على المهام.
    الطائرة - نظام مفتوح لتتبع الأخطاء وإدارة المشاريع
  • دعم عرض جدول العمل على شكل مخطط شريطي تقويمي (Gantt Chart).
    الطائرة - نظام مفتوح لتتبع الأخطاء وإدارة المشاريع
  • دعم لربط السمات الخاصة بك وتخصيص النمط والألوان.
  • تمت إعادة تصميم واجهة دورة التطوير.
    الطائرة - نظام مفتوح لتتبع الأخطاء وإدارة المشاريع
  • تم توسيع المعلومات المعروضة في عرض التقويم.
    الطائرة - نظام مفتوح لتتبع الأخطاء وإدارة المشاريع

المصدر: opennet.ru

إضافة تعليق